Abstract
The utility model discloses a kind of device for fixing concrete flange template, including rotary screw, template fixing groove, connecting rod, slip fixed block, fixed block, steel holding holes, convex block, groove, overmolded bottom plate, nut, bottom plate, sliding groove, bolt and sliding shoe.The beneficial effects of the utility model are:The structure simple structure, flexibility is strong, overmolded cushion block is connected on beam form cushion block, and it is connected between beam form cushion block and overmolded cushion block by rotatable connecting rod, the angle of freely adjustable overmolded cushion block, use scope is wide, it is and easy to operate, by the slip fixed block fixed form of adjustable dimension, the template of different-thickness is applicable to, the number of plies for the reinforcing bar that bump height can be as needed is freely set, and reinforcing bar fixation, installation procedure is easy, has good economic benefit and social benefit, is suitble to promote the use of.

Background technology
Concrete flanging will be carried out in each top edge of constructing, waterproof is realized with this, blocks water, therefore for concrete
The work of flange is essential, and in practice, when pouring top plate, it is impossible to the good concrete flanging of effective primary concreting,
It is generally necessary to top plate pour after carry out it is secondary pour, process is relatively complicated.
The cushion block connectivity of traditional fixing concrete flanged side mold is poor, and template is easy to fall off, has gone out after concreting
Existing crack phenomenon of rupture, later stage easy leak, on the other hand, the cushion block fixed angle list of traditional fixing concrete flanged side mold
One, when realizing the flange template of fixed different angle, it is necessary to use multiple cushion blocks, process flow is more, and cost obtains not
To control, furthermore, the fixation of reinforcing bar is also needed to be bound with iron wire, it is inconvenient for operation, therefore, a kind of use is proposed regarding to the issue above
In the device of fixing concrete flange template.

When the utility model is used, it according to actual needs, is rotatablely connected bar 3 and overmolded bottom plate 9 adjusts angle, then twist
Tight nut 10, template is stuck in template fixing groove 2, and sliding shoe 14 is slided along sliding groove 12 and groove 8, that is, is slided solid
Block 4 is determined constantly to template proximate, until being adjacent to template, then tightens rotary screw 1, template is fixed tightly, then flange template
Fixation finishes, and then according to the number of plies of actually required reinforcing bar, selects corresponding convex block 7, and convex block 7 is mounted on overmolded bottom plate
On, steel holding holes 6 are inserted into reinforcing bar one end, then each bolt 13 is fixed tightly, it installs, flange template is with turning over beam
Template is connected, and concrete flanging disposably is poured completion.
